What You’ll Be Doing:
- Review and verify customer documentation
- Create / Format / Edit / Update technical content and diagrams in support of customer documentation
- Review content changes with internal and external authors
- Follow / track assigned tasks from start until completion using bug tracking tool
What You’ll Need:
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ills in English, both verbal and written required
- Advanced experience with Microsoft Office required (Word, PowerPoint, Excel)
- Experience with Microsoft Visio, considered highly beneficial
- Visual design skills to produce appealing, engaging, and detailed documents
- Ability to work independently as well as within a team environment
- Must demonstrate attention to detail
- Ability to meet tight deadlines, prioritize work, and multi-task
- Knowledge of computer architecture, circuit theory, and integrated circuit design a plus
Key Program Facts:
- Program Length: 16 months
- Location: Ontario, Canada
- Working Model: In-office
- Full-Time/Part-Time: Full-time
- Start Date: May 2025
